Warren's All Stars said:
CONGRATS - quite an accomplishment!

If you don't mind, can you relay the history of the Milton Bradley version? I never knew about that one...

from what I have heard over the years they were recieved through some sort of redemption on milton bradleys part. PSA will not grade them but for some reason bvg does. The little information I have has come from different collectors I have talked through on a few different boards. The miltons seem to be some what rarer than the opg. I would guess that there is 1 opg for every 100 topps. There is likly 1 milton brabley for every 2-3 opgs.
